Subject: SDK parity check — Fernwell clients

Quick status for release planning: the Orbitail Swift SDK is now at full feature parity with the Kotlin SDK, including offline queueing and retry policies. Remaining gaps from last cycle are closed and covered by the shared conformance suite. Parity was verified against the following build:

session token of yajof-bagef = htk4_937d

Ticket: Fan-out workers rejecting plugin callbacks

Plugin authors: the Squallcast weather-alert fan-out sandbox was deployed with a stale credential, so callback deliveries return 403. We've rotated it and redeployed. To resume receiving test alerts, update your plugin's env file so it contains the following line:

sealed setting: LEDGER_TOKEN13=5d842615a26d7

**Ticket: Nightfill scheduler creds expired — backfills stalled**

Heads up for the sync: the Nightfill scheduler stopped kicking off the 2 a.m. backfills because its credential to the Droverly ingest service lapsed over the weekend. Nothing was lost, jobs just queued up. Marit reran Saturday's batch manually and it's clean. I've provisioned a replacement credential with a 90-day expiry so this doesn't sneak up again. The new key is below.

service key, bajep-hahig: zpat15_8GdlyV2kd9BCqYH

## Orders: soft deletes

At Pellworth, rows in the orders table are never hard-deleted. We set deleted_at and exclude flagged rows via the active_orders view; reviewers should reject any query that bypasses it. Purge jobs run quarterly and require a signed manifest. The purge tooling verifies that manifest against our current signing key, which is as follows.

rollout seal: bky4_x7Gc